August 30, 2013 — A colossal and previously unmapped canyon has been found under Greenlandâs ice sheet. The canyon is 750km long, almost twice the length of the Grand Canyon in Arizona. Graphic shows location of the Greenland Canyon

A previously unknown canyon has been discovered in Greenland, hidden beneath the ice. It is at least 750 kilometres long. To put that in perspective, imagine a ten kilometre wide gorge, up to 800 metres deep, running from the Southern coast of England and into Scotland. This is on the same scale as parts of the Grand Canyon.

>Jonathan Bamber , who led the research, was originally mapping Greenland’s bedrock, which was previously thought to be relatively flat and smooth. “Unexpectedly, we found an enormous apparent formation,” he said. “We looked at it in more detail, and realised it was a canyon.” 

The canyon, which is thought to predate glaciation, has remained hidden beneath two kilometres of ice for more than four million years. It has the characteristics of a meandering river channel, an ancient river system that Bamber thinks hasn’t been significantly modified by ice cover.

It is almost twice the length of the Grand Canyon, half as deep but almost as wide, and certainly the only feature in Greenland this long.

The discovery of such an enormous geographical formation seems astounding today. We’d probably assume that geographical exploration and mapping were exhausted after the development of satellite mapping.

“This really is quite remarkable,” Bamber said. “In an age when you have Google street view covering the entirety of the inhabited world, when virtually every house is mapped. In this context, to discover a geological feature of such scale is astonishing.”

>Timothy James , a glaciologist at the University of Swansea, agrees. “This is very exciting news,” he said. “Although, I’m not really surprised.” 

“Considerable effort has been put into collecting bed topography of the Greenland ice sheet recently, and there is a lot of data to be processed and interpreted.”

Accuracy is difficult if the bed proves to be highly featured, which now seems to be the case. James explained that there is much more to be discovered. Take the case of >the bed data recently released

“It has a spatial resolution of 1 km and vertical error that ranges from ±10 m to ±300 m,” he explained. “I’m sure there are many secrets left to discover beneath Greenland’s ice, and likewise in Antarctica.”

The data was collected over several decades by NASA and researchers from the UK and Germany. Radio waves of certain frequencies can travel through ice, but bounce off the bedrock beneath. So researchers sent down pulses of radio energy of this particular frequency. By analysing this radar data, the team were able to map the topography of the underlying bedrock.

Of course, the area contributes to sea level rise, and therefore the findings should help researchers to understand current changes.

“The canyon is significant when we think about the movement of the underlying water,” said Bamber. “This lubricates the ice sheet, and therefore determines the speed at which it moves.”

“We think the canyon is an efficient conduit for ice-melt from the glacier. If you want to model glacial movement – something that is ever more crucial due to global warming – then knowing about such topography is very important.”

The discovery shouldn’t affect our forecasts for future sea level in itself, but it does highlights that we still don’t know everything about the surface of our own planet.

Recent glacier retreat across the Andes is unprecedented in the history of human civilization, according to a new study published in the Science journal on Thursday.

The discovery shocked scientists, who initially planned to study the current state of glaciers and how they had varied throughout human civilization.


Also read | Explained: How glaciers, glacial lakes form and why they break

“We thought this result was decades away,” said Andrew Gorin, lead author of the study, who first believed the initial results were a fluke, but were confirmed by later samples.

“It goes to show you that this is happening faster than even those of us that think about this the most believed.”

Mr. Gorin and the team of scientists carbon-dated bedrock that had been recently exposed by retreated glaciers by measuring beryllium-10 and carbon-14 nuclide levels and found that concentrations were nearly zero.

“Basically, if your rock can see the sky, it’s accumulating these nuclides,” Gorin said, adding that the decay rate of these nuclides show that the rock hadn’t been exposed during the Holocene Era, which dates back 11,700 years, but could go back even further.

“I would bet my whole life savings that in fact, these glaciers are smaller than they’ve been since the last interglacial period,” which ended about 115,000 years ago, Mr. Gorin said.

The study collected data at four glaciers across the Andes, which comprises 99% of the world’s tropical glaciers. These glaciers are more susceptible to changing weather since they’re consistently at or near freezing point.

“We think this is the canary in the coal mine, that this is going to happen everywhere before long and maybe sooner than we thought,” Mr. Gorin said.
